使用一个 IMAP 和一个 POP 客户端同步电子邮件

使用一个 IMAP 和一个 POP 客户端同步电子邮件

好吧,我有一个奇怪的情况:

我需要将单个服务器上的单个电子邮件帐户中的电子邮件同步到两个不同的电子邮件客户端。我需要从电子邮件服务器中删除电子邮件。

我尝试设置这些帐户,以便一个帐户使用 POP 来删除和同步电子邮件,另一个帐户使用 IMAP 来同步电子邮件,但这只会在客户端之间创建竞争条件,并导致只有一些电子邮件被传递到 IMAP 客户端。

有人知道有更好的方法来实现我的目标吗?

答案1

我认为这会变得很混乱。

您必须让两个客户端都使用 IMAP 进行连接,因为其他方法都行不通。然后,您需要找到一种方法让两个客户端都表明它们已经完成复制,然后您需要一个识别该信号并删除电子邮件的服务器进程。不太好。当客户端复制时,如果收到更多电子邮件会发生什么?我认为您必须先停止电子邮件服务器 - 明白我说的混乱了吧?

因此,让我们稍微回顾一下。为什么你想这样做吗?如果你能解释一下,我敢打赌我们可以想出更好的方法。

相关内容